"Computer Aided Design of Jaw crusher"

Jaw crusher movement is guided by pivoting one end of the swinging jaw. and an eccentric motion located at the opposite end. [4] The size of a jaw crusher is designated by the rectangular or square opening at the top of the jaws .For instance, a 22 x 30 jaw crusher has an opening of 22" by 30", a 46 x 46 jaw crusher has a opening of 46" square.

Jaw Crusher

Crushers. Barry A. Wills, James A. Finch FRSC, FCIM, P.Eng., in Wills' Mineral Processing Technology (Eighth Edition), 2016 Jaw-crusher Construction. Jaw crushers are heavy-duty machines and hence must be robustly constructed. The main frame is often made from cast iron or steel, connected with tie-bolts. It is commonly made in sections so that it can be transported …

Understanding Jaw Crusher Parts and Their Functions

Introduction: Jaw crushers are powerful machines that are widely used in the mining, quarrying, and recycling industries. These machines are designed to crush large rocks and ores into smaller pieces for further processing. A jaw crusher consists of a fixed jaw and a movable jaw, with the latter being driven by an eccentric shaft that moves the jaw up and down.

Jaw Crusher Working Principle

The jaw crusher discharge opening is the distance from the valley between corrugations on one jaw to the top of the mating corrugation on the other jaw. The crusher discharge opening governs the size of finished material …
